Forms Authentication using Xml File
Hi,
May I know how can I use Forms Authentication without storing my
credentials information in web.Config but in some other Xml file of my own .
Since I am creating users at runtime I need to store username and passwords
in a different xml file which i need to use to authenticate the users. But
how do i inform Forms Authentication about this b'coz as far as i know it
searches the credentials section in Web.Config file for authenticating the
users.
Any advice would be helpful.
